More than ten kilometers of service corridors bring steam, electricity, natural gas, compressed air, and domestic, demineralized and chilled water to the Greater Campus Area. Benefiting from District Energy. Owning and operating our own district energy system has many benefits. District energy systems give off fewer emissions than conventional energy systems. By managing our power production and natural gas purchases, we reduce operating costs for the university. Our district energy system gives us flexibility and control over our energy production and consumption. As UAlberta grows, we will continue to meet its utility needs. Compared to a conventional energy system, our district energy system saves the university millions of dollars a year. That means the university can invest more money in teaching and research.
